Disregarding the article, although twas amusing to read.
If vista is so fantastic, why are they talking very seriously about the so called Windows 7, vista has barely been out five minutes.
I take no interest in operating systems or software side of computers, it annoys me too much. Hard enough trying to keep up with hardware developments, so the above is a genuine question.
XP was super stable when it was released everyone singing its praises (blue screens a thing of the past etc), now, over time, it reverts to the slow decay indicative of all MS operating systems, your computer takes longer to boot up, longer to do everything, more errors etc as crap accumulates, and windows proves to be frail once again.
Vista will do the same in time, they are all one and the same.
Why can't they design a platform and stick with it, not keep inventing the wheel every few years.
